Hogwired.com: Alabama Wins Series with 9-5 Victory Over Hogs
Emeel Salem’s seventh-inning two-run home run put a stake in No. 8 Arkansas on a smoldering afternoon in front of 4,206 fans at Sewell-Thomas Stadium as Alabama handed the Razorbacks their first SEC-series loss on the road this season.
